The 53 µH inductance limits current rise rates and reduces harmonic distortion on the line side of a drive or rectifier. Thermal class H (180 °C) insulation allows it to run hot in a closed cabinet without derating, though the 280 W coil loss and 170 W iron core loss must be ventilated. The 0.227 m depth, 0.35 m width, and 0.321 m height define the footprint; verify clearance around the unit for airflow and the minimum bend radius of the incoming cables.
Siemens 4EU3622-0AA00-0AA0 Commutating Choke, 500A, 53µH
Siemens 4EU3622-0AA00-0AA0 commutating choke for converter, 3-phase, 400V AC, 50Hz, rated 450A (500A max), 53µH, IP00, flat-type terminals, thermal class H.

What are the key electrical ratings for 4EU3622-0AA00-0AA0?
It is a 3-phase commutating choke rated 450 A continuous (500 A maximum) at 400 V AC, 50 Hz, with 53 µH inductance and a 4% relative inductive voltage drop.

What is the physical size of 4EU3622-0AA00-0AA0?
The dimensions are 0.227 m depth, 0.35 m width, and 0.321 m height. It is an open-frame (IP00) component for panel mounting with flat-type terminals.
